InstaPURE: Our dry fog solution to treat mould

Our technology is patented and was created in the USA. We are the exclusive UK licensees of our parent company Pure Maintenance. This is important as the entire process was created to comply with strict US regulations. We deliver a service using authorised actives rather than selling a product. We apply InstaPURE under a COSHH assessment to oxidise and destroy mould and its spores, then prove the result.

InstaPURE breaks down into vinegar (acetic acid), water and oxygen, leaving no lasting residue.

More importantly, the patented fogger we use to administer InstaPURE forces the sterilant into such a small particle size that it is unable to condense. This is what gives the fog its characteristic 'dryness'. This means the fog doesn't condense on surfaces but rather dwells in the air. It's this property that facilitates InstaPURE's unique ability to reduce airborne mould spores and reduce harmful mycotoxins. The fogger creates positive air pressure by filling the airspace with InstaPURE until the entire volume of the room is filled. We treat in a sealed room and hold the fog there, so it reaches every surface the air touches. This is how we achieve systematic and comprehensive coverage. Because it can't condense, once we open the windows upon concluding the first phase of treatment, the air pressure falls and the sterilant disperses. Once the windows are open and the room's aired out, the sterilant disperses - no lasting residue in the home you return to.

EverPURE: Our solution to stop mould from reappearing

EverPURE is our anti-microbial film. We apply it once all mould in the home has been treated and wiped away. It bonds to the surfaces it's applied to, giving a durable antimicrobial layer that helps resist regrowth. The anti-microbial film is made up of positively charged nitrogen molecules with carbon atoms stacked on top. Microscopically, it looks like a bed of nails as the carbon atoms create a spike. Any new pathogens introduced to the property following our treatment are electrostatically attracted to the positive charge and the carbon spike pierces the outer membrane, denaturing the microbe.

As with InstaPURE, EverPURE is applied under a COSHH assessment and in line with HSE requirements; the actives are authorised at manufacturer level. We deliver a service rather than selling a product. We do recommend storing any food in cupboards or refrigerators as it can affect the taste of the food.

Furthermore, EverPURE is a mineral-based solution. This is important as the way in which it 'kills' mould is mechanical. In other words, it doesn't change the organic property of a mould cell. It physically treats the mould.
